Saving and Managing Inline Applicability Expressions
You can save and manage applicability expressions in Arbortext Editorusing the Save and Open Saved options available in the Apply Inline Applicability dialog box.
To save an applicability expression for reuse in future authoring sessions, click Save in the Apply Inline Applicability dialog box. The Save Expression dialog box opens. In this dialog, you can use the default Option Set name or enter a custom name in the Saved Expression Group Name field. This name is used to group saved expressions. Repeat this step to save additional expressions as required.
To view the previously saved expression(s), click Open Saved in the Apply Inline Applicability dialog box. The Manage Saved Expressions dialog box opens. A dropdown displays all saved Option Set. The system defaults to the current Option Set, but you can select another desired set from the list. The Saved Expression list displays expressions grouped under that set. Select the required expression and click Use to add it to the Logical Expression list. Click Delete to remove expressions that are no longer needed. If all expressions in an Option Set are deleted, the Option Set name is automatically removed when the dialog box is closed.
Saved expressions are stored in a system-generated file called SavedApplicabilityExpressions, located in the same directory as the arbortext.wcf file.
The default location is C:Users\<username>\AppData\Roaming\PTC\Arbortext\Editor\.
You can share this file if required. This file is managed automatically and does not require manual editing.
